White House Correspondents’ Dinner party invites rolling in

This year’s “nerd prom” is  weeks away, and the invites are already starting to pour in.

MS Now will host its first White House Correspondents’ Dinner event under its new name and owner, while its former sister station, NBC, will return this year to host a party.

The Status newsletter, edited by Oliver Darcy (here at left with Donny O’Sullivan at CBS’s WHCD bash in 2023), is hosting a party on the Thursday before the main dinner. Getty Images for CBS News

Condé Nast and CAA have a bash, with Mark Guiducci making his WHCD debut as the new editor of Vanity Fair.

Creator platform beehiiv will also make an appearance, sponsoring Oliver Darcy’s Status party on Thursday and its own bash Friday night, which is co-sponsored by Shinola.

“Fantastic Four” star Michael Chiklis will chair a dinner for the Creative Coalition at PubKey in DC, and CBS News senior White House correspondent Weijia Jiang will attend this year as president of the White House Correspondents’ Association.

Weijia Jiang, the White House Correspondents’ Association’s president, will host a bash. Getty Images

She said she’s looking forward to hosting President Trump, who previously boycotted the dinner. The main event takes place April 25 with mentalist Oz Pearlman as the headline entertainer.

Donald Trump will attend for the first time since 2011. Getty Images

The press-hating prez is attending this year for the first time as president. He famously attended in 2011 when then-president Barack Obama mercilessly roasted him.
